Understanding Electric Fences


Electric fences consist of a series of electrified wires designed to deliver a mild shock to deter intruders or unwanted animals. Often used in agricultural settings, they have gained popularity in residential and commercial security applications as well. Electric fences are typically powered by a energizer, which produces a pulse of electricity to the wires. The system is designed to deliver a shock that is startling but not lethal, making it a humane option for encasing livestock or enhancing perimeters.


One of the main advantages of electric fences is their adaptability. They can be easily modified to suit different terrains and are scalable. This means that property owners can customize their electric fencing to meet specific needs, whether it’s maintaining a secure barrier around a large estate or a small garden. Furthermore, electric fences are often less intrusive than traditional solid fencing systems, allowing visibility while still offering a high level of security.


The Role of Razor Wire


Razor wire, also known as barbed tape, is another robust security measure commonly used in high-security environments. Composed of sharp blades affixed to wire strands, razor wire effectively prevents unauthorized access. Unlike barbed wire, which has larger, spaced-out barbs, razor wire features smaller, sharper edges that make it significantly harder to breach.


Typically seen in military installations, prisons, and secure facilities, razor wire is often combined with fencing systems to enhance security. Its intimidating appearance naturally deters potential intruders, serving as both a physical barrier and psychological deterrent.

Security Benefits


Both electric fences and razor wire share the common goal of providing security, yet they offer distinct advantages. Electric fences can be installed relatively quickly and require minimal maintenance. They can cover expansive areas without the need for physical barriers, reducing costs significantly. Additionally, modern electric fences come equipped with alarms and monitoring systems, alerting property owners to any breaches in real-time.


On the other hand, razor wire is valued for its durability and resistance to tampering. It is typically made from galvanized steel, which can withstand harsh weather conditions. Furthermore, the physical presence of razor wire can deter potential intruders simply through its menacing appearance.


Considerations for Use


While both electric fences and razor wire are effective security solutions, there are important considerations to keep in mind. Local laws and regulations regarding the use of electric fencing and razor wire should be reviewed before installation. In some areas, there are restrictions on the height, design, and warning signage required for electric fences. Similarly, razor wire usage may be limited in residential areas due to safety concerns.


Another factor to consider is the ethical implications of these security measures. Electric fences, while typically humane, must be used responsibly to prevent accidental harm to wildlife or pets. Razor wire poses more significant safety risks and may not be suitable for all environments, particularly where children or non-combatants may be present.
